Your retirement plan isn't required to just accept rollover contributions. Check with your new plan administrator to discover When they are allowed and, If that's the case, what type of contributions are recognized.

Even so, if you have a Roth 401(k) and roll your funds into a Roth IRA, you might not have to bother with shelling out any additional tax Unless of course you have pre-tax employer contributions you’re rolling over.

An IRA rollover is generally the transfer visit the website of belongings involving two, non-like retirement accounts, for example from a 457(b) to an IRA. IRA rollovers have distinct rules according to how the funds are transferred (directly or indirectly) as well as the type of account you're rolling from and into.
